class sockethelper
{
//eventemitters是另外的一个类,方法里的东西也不要去管public sockethelper(eventemitters eventemitters)
{
event enendata = new event(new callback2delegate(onsend), null);
eventemitters.on("senddata", enendata);

this.eventemitters = eventemitters;
thread = new thread(run);
type = true;
thread.start();
} 
}
  

上面的是父类,然后子类实现父类的构造函数,另外建一个类起名为socketserver,继承上一个类sockethelper(此时sockethelper为父类):

namespace actionclient
{
// :后面sockethelper是父类,子类继承父类 class socketserver : sockethelper {
      //必须实现父类里的构造方法, 用base关键字 public socketserver(eventemitters eventemitters) : base(eventemitters) { } } }

ok,这样就是子类继承父类的构造函数

子类继承父类的时候,其基类的构造函数,子类也要必须实现,不然会报错